大数据分析编程技术是什么

回复

共3条回复 我来回复
  • 大数据分析编程技术是一种通过编程语言和工具来处理、分析和可视化大规模数据的技术。大数据分析编程技术在当今信息时代具有重要意义,可以帮助企业深入了解数据背后的信息,并做出更明智的决策。本文将从大数据分析编程技术的基本概念、应用、常用工具等方面进行讨论。

    一、大数据分析编程技术的基本概念

    大数据分析编程技术是指利用计算机程序对大规模数据进行处理、分析和挖掘的技术。其核心思想是通过代码和算法来发现数据中的模式、趋势和规律,从中提炼出有价值的信息。大数据分析编程技术能够帮助用户从海量数据中发现隐藏的信息,实现数据驱动决策和业务优化。

    二、大数据分析编程技术的应用领域

    大数据分析编程技术广泛应用于各行各业,包括但不限于以下领域:

    1. 金融领域:利用大数据分析技术对金融市场数据进行分析,为投资决策提供依据;
    2. 医疗领域:通过分析患者的病例数据,提高医疗诊断的准确性和效率;
    3. 零售领域:利用消费者行为数据进行分析,优化产品推荐和促销策略;
    4. 物流领域:通过分析运输数据,优化运输路线和降低成本;
    5. 互联网领域:利用大数据分析技术进行用户行为分析和个性化推荐。

    三、大数据分析编程技术的常用工具

    大数据分析编程技术的常用工具主要有以下几种:

    1. Python:Python是一种简洁、易读的编程语言,广泛应用于数据分析和科学计算领域;
    2. R语言:R语言是一种专门为数据分析和统计计算设计的编程语言,拥有丰富的数据处理和可视化功能;
    3. SQL:结构化查询语言(SQL)是一种用于管理和分析关系型数据库的标准化语言,广泛用于大数据处理;
    4. Hadoop:Hadoop是一个开源的分布式计算框架,用于存储和处理大规模数据;
    5. Spark:Spark是一个快速、通用、可扩展的大数据处理引擎,支持实时数据处理和机器学习。

    四、总结

    大数据分析编程技术是一种处理和分析大规模数据的重要技术,应用范围广泛。掌握大数据分析编程技术可以帮助个人和企业更好地理解数据,并做出更准确的决策。随着大数据技术的不断发展,相信大数据分析编程技术将在未来发挥越来越重要的作用。

    2年前 0条评论
  • 大数据分析编程技术是指利用编程和计算机技术处理和分析海量数据的方法和工具。它包括一系列的编程语言、框架、工具和算法,用于从所收集的大规模数据中提取有用信息、识别模式、进行预测等任务。下面是关于大数据分析编程技术的一些重要方面:

    1. 编程语言:在大数据分析中,常用的编程语言包括Python、R、Java和Scala。Python是一种灵活、易学易用的语言,广泛应用于数据处理和分析任务;R语言是专门用于统计分析的语言,在学术界和数据科学领域广泛使用;Java和Scala则常用于大数据处理框架中,如Apache Hadoop和Apache Spark。

    2. 大数据处理框架:Apache Hadoop和Apache Spark是两个流行的大数据处理框架。Hadoop是一个用于分布式存储和计算的框架,支持大规模数据集的批处理任务;Spark则是一个基于内存计算的框架,比Hadoop更快速且适用于迭代式计算和实时数据处理。

    3. 数据管理和存储:在大数据环境下,数据管理和存储是至关重要的。常用的工具包括Apache HBase(面向列存储的分布式数据库)、Apache Cassandra(分布式NoSQL数据库)和Apache Kafka(用于实时数据流处理的消息队列)。

    4. 数据分析算法:大数据分析中常用的算法包括数据挖掘、机器学习和深度学习算法。数据挖掘技术用于发现数据中的模式和关联;机器学习算法用于建立数据模型和进行预测;深度学习算法则适用于处理非结构化数据,如图像和语音。

    5. 可视化工具:数据可视化是将分析结果以直观易懂的图形展示出来的过程,帮助用户理解数据和分析结果。常用的可视化工具包括Matplotlib、Seaborn和D3.js等。

    通过掌握这些大数据分析编程技术,研究人员和数据科学家能够更高效地处理庞大的数据集,挖掘其中的知识,并为决策提供有力支持。

    2年前 0条评论
  • 大数据分析编程技术是指利用编程语言和工具从海量、多样化的数据中提取、分析、挖掘有价值的信息和见解的技术。在当今信息爆炸的时代,大数据分析已经成为许多企业和组织获取竞争优势的重要手段。通过大数据分析编程技术,可以帮助企业把握市场动态,发现潜在商机,提高生产效率,降低成本,优化决策等。

    大数据分析编程技术涉及到多种编程语言、工具和技术,下面将从方法、操作流程等方面详细介绍大数据分析编程技术。

    1. 数据采集

    数据采集是大数据分析的第一步,数据质量和多样性对后续分析的结果起着决定性作用。数据可以来自各种来源,比如数据库、日志文件、传感器、社交媒体等。常用的数据采集技术包括爬虫技术、日志收集技术、API接口调用等。

    2. 数据清洗

    大部分原始数据并不是完全干净的,会存在缺失值、异常值、重复值等问题,需要进行数据清洗。数据清洗包括数据去重、缺失值处理、异常值处理、数据格式转换等步骤,保证数据的准确性和完整性。

    3. 数据存储

    存储是大数据分析的重要一环,在数据量庞大的情况下,如何高效、可靠地存储数据至关重要。常用的数据存储技术包括关系型数据库、NoSQL数据库、分布式文件系统等。根据实际需求选择适当的存储技术。

    4. 数据处理

    数据处理是大数据分析的核心环节,包括数据清洗、数据转换、数据聚合、数据计算等操作。常用的数据处理技术包括MapReduce、Spark、Hadoop等。通过这些技术可以高效地处理大规模数据,进行复杂的计算和分析。

    5. 数据分析

    数据分析是大数据应用最关键的环节,通过统计分析、机器学习、深度学习等技术从海量数据中挖掘出有价值的信息和见解。常用的数据分析工具包括Python的NumPy、Pandas、Scikit-learn库,R语言等。

    6. 数据可视化

    数据可视化是将分析结果直观地展示给用户的重要手段,可以帮助用户更好地理解数据、发现规律和趋势。常用的数据可视化工具包括Matplotlib、Seaborn、Tableau等,可以生成各种图表、报表和仪表盘。

    7. 模型评估

    在数据分析中,模型评估是评价模型性能的关键环节,可以通过各种指标来评估分析模型的准确性、泛化能力等。常用的评估指标包括准确率、召回率、F1值等,可以帮助分析师不断优化模型。

    通过以上步骤,利用大数据分析编程技术可以帮助企业和组织更好地理解数据、洞察市场、优化运营,提升竞争力。同时,大数据分析编程技术也在不断发展和完善,为更深入、更全面的数据应用提供了更多可能性。

    2年前 0条评论
站长微信
站长微信
分享本页
返回顶部